Fire Damages 5-Story Building In Hoboken
HOBOKEN, N.J. (CBSNewYork) -- A raging fire caused heavy damage at a building in Hoboken Sunday.
Flames shot through the roof of the five-story building on Washington Street.
The lower floor houses a convenience store, with apartments above. Parts of the fourth and fifth floors collapsed.
There are no reports of serious injuries and everyone inside reportedly exited the building safely.
There was no word yet on the cause of the fire.
